Rectory (Immeldorf)
The rectory in Immeldorf , a district of the market town of Lichtenau in the Central Franconian district of Ansbach in Bavaria , was built in 1754. The rectory on Hauptstrasse 17/19 right next to the Evangelical Lutheran parish church of St. Georg is a protected architectural monument .
The two-storey hipped roof building in the corner has four to five window axes . The frames of the windows and the portal as well as the cornice are made of sandstone .
